> You've likely read an article about The Byte Order Fallacy. While I
> agree in principle I disagree in practice. No one in this day and age or
> any other I can imagine would split a scalar load/store into discrete
> parts by the byte to be cross portable. It also doesn't produce
> efficient code.

As someone who has written a lot of SIMD code and cryptographic code
-- and timed the operations -- I can say it does matter in practice.
It may be the operation is a nop for one endian, and a byte swap for
another endian. But it does matter.

> Even on x64 the latest GCC doesn't even know or doesn't
> figure out what code is doing that reads data bytes and shifts it in
> place. For either endian. It doesn't see what is going on to reduce it
> to direct access or a movebe. It lacks endian AI.

Yeah, it is hit or miss whether Clang and GCC will produce optimal
code for some endian related patterns, like reading a byte array and
turning it into a machine word.
